Summary

Mozilla Corporation is seeking a Staff Operations Engineer to maintain and improve critical systems. The role involves managing Identity Access Management system, coordinating deployment of resources in GCP and AWS, handling SSL/TLS certificates, administering DNS and IPAM, contributing to projects, leading multi-functional groups, documenting status and procedures, and functioning with a customer service mentality. The position requires 6+ years of experience in DevOps, SRE, or CloudOps, proficiency in Python and JavaScript, experience with cloud computing such as AWS and GCP, 3+ years experience in Identity Access Management products and frameworks, and commitment to Mozilla's values.
